Why Storm Damage Here Is Different
Salt Air and Metal Fatigue
Homes closer to open water and exposed fields deal with salt-laden air more than roofs further inland or in heavily wooded neighborhoods. Salt accelerates corrosion on exposed metal — flashing, nail heads, gutter fasteners, vent caps. A storm that would just knock a few shingles loose on a fresher roof can tear through flashing that's already been quietly corroding for years, and that's often where the real leak starts, not at the shingles themselves.
Driving Rain and Wind-Driven Water
Storms in this part of Whatcom County rarely come straight down. Wind pushes rain sideways, which means water gets forced up under shingle edges, into vent boots, and around chimney and skylight flashing that would stay dry in a calm rain. After a storm, the damage isn't always where the wind visibly tore something loose — it's often a few feet away, where water found a gap that wind pressure opened up.
Moss Season and Weakened Roof Decking
This region has a long moss season — mild, damp stretches that run for months and give moss plenty of time to establish on north-facing slopes and shaded sections of roof. Moss holds moisture against the roofing material and, over time, lifts shingle edges and traps water against the decking underneath. A roof with moss buildup going into storm season is already compromised before the wind even shows up, which is part of why storm damage tends to hit harder on roofs that haven't had moss addressed in a while.
What a Correct Storm Damage Repair Actually Involves
A lot of storm repair work gets done by patching the visible problem and calling it done. That approach misses the underlying cause more often than not. A repair that actually holds up involves a few distinct steps:
1. Full Roof Assessment, Not Just the Obvious Spot
We look at the whole roof, not just where the leak showed up inside the house. Water travels along decking and rafters before it drips somewhere visible, so the interior stain and the actual entry point are frequently in different locations. We check flashing, valleys, vent boots, ridge caps, and shingle condition across every slope, including the shaded sides where moss tends to build up.
2. Identifying Storm Damage vs. Pre-Existing Wear
This matters for two reasons: it affects whether the damage may be covered by homeowners insurance, and it affects what the repair actually needs to include. A shingle torn loose in a windstorm is a different repair than a shingle that was already brittle and cracking from age or moss damage. We'll tell you plainly which is which — we're not going to call something "storm damage" just because it's convenient.
3. Repairing the Cause, Not Just the Symptom
If flashing corroded by salt air is what let water in, replacing a shingle over it without addressing the flashing just delays the next leak. A proper repair replaces or reseals the failed component — flashing, boot, decking section, or shingle course — with materials suited to what actually failed.
4. Matching Materials and Finish
Where possible, repairs use matching or closely matched shingle color and profile so the patched section doesn't stand out as an obvious repair. On older roofs where exact matches aren't available, we'll walk you through the realistic options rather than guessing and hoping it blends.

Common Storm Damage We See and How Each Is Handled
| Damage Type | Typical Cause | Repair Approach |
|---|---|---|
| Missing or torn shingles | Wind uplift, often on edges and ridges | Replace affected shingles, check underlying decking and felt for exposure damage |
| Flashing leaks (chimney, skylight, valleys) | Salt-air corrosion combined with wind-driven rain | Remove and replace corroded flashing, reseal with proper underlayment integration |
| Vent boot cracking | Age and UV/weather cycling, worsened by storm flexing | Replace boot, check for water tracking into surrounding decking |
| Moss-related shingle lift | Long moss season on shaded slopes | Remove moss, treat affected area, replace lifted or damaged shingles |
| Localized decking rot | Prolonged undetected leak, often moss-related | Cut out and replace affected decking before re-shingling |
Cost Factors for Storm Damage Repair
Every roof and every storm event is different, so we don't quote a flat number without seeing the roof. That said, a few things consistently drive cost up or down:
- Scope of damage — a handful of shingles is a very different job than damaged decking or multiple flashing points.
- Roof access and pitch — steeper or harder-to-access roofs take longer and require more safety setup.
- How long the damage went unaddressed — water that's been getting in for weeks does more damage than a fresh storm hit.
- Material availability — matching older shingle profiles or colors can take longer to source.
- Insurance coordination — documentation and claim-related timelines can affect scheduling, though not the actual repair cost.
Most storm damage repairs in this area fall into a moderate range rather than a full roof replacement — but we won't know which category your roof is in until we look at it.

What to Check Before You Call
If you're not sure whether you need a repair call yet, here's a quick checklist:
- New ceiling stains, especially after a windy or heavy-rain night
- Shingles visible in the yard or gutters after a storm
- Visible gaps, lifted edges, or curling on any roof slope
- Moss buildup that's thick enough to see from the ground on shaded slopes
- Rust streaks or corrosion visible on flashing around chimneys or vents
- Sagging or soft spots when walking the attic (if safely accessible)
If any of these apply, it's worth getting a look before the next storm system rather than waiting for the leak to get worse.
